Listeria outbreak linked to Ice Cream

-A listeria outbreak that caused one death in Illinois and sickened at least 23 other people has been linked to a Florida ice cream brand, according to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.

SC Motor Fuel User Fee to go up 2 cents in July

Starting tomorrow, drivers across the state will see an extra two cents tacked on to gas prices, as part of the state's Motor Fuel User Fee, which helps support road, bridge and infrastructure construction across the state.

1 arrest as abortion protesters fill SC Statehouse lobby

A 32-year-old woman was arrested and charged with misdemeanor assault as abortion protesters spent about 90 minutes inside the lobby of the South Carolina Statehouse during Tuesday's special session on the state budget, authorities said.

SC House agrees to knock $25M computer out of $14B budget

The South Carolina General Assembly overturned many of Gov. Henry McMasters budget vetoes Tuesday, but they did agree with the biggest one, taking $25 million out of the $13.8 billion spending plan to try to help bring a super computer to Columbia.
